However, based upon five trials that reported on use of pain medication, the authors of the review wrapped up that there was a decline in pain medication usage by 21% to 86% in the hypnosis groups contrasted to usual treatment alone. Previous research has defined decreases on discomfort strength complying with hypnosis throughout a selection of other chronic discomfort conditions41,42,43,44,45,46,47,48. Nevertheless, and regardless of the excellent results produced by the existing study on pain disturbance, similar renovations on pain strength were not discovered. One feasible explanation for this outcome might be the long period of time of pain within this sample of patients. Regarding we realize, there are no research studies checking out hypnotherapy performance amongst patients with such a lengthy pain duration as in this pilot trial, with around 70% of the individuals having discomfort for over 20 years. In the literary works examined on this subject, the highest possible mean pain duration determined was 13 years47. A second current meta-analysis of 12 clinical trials discovered that hypnotherapy was a lot more reliable for managing persistent discomfort than various other emotional treatments such as leisure,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), and biofeedback. Former researches have previously reported the application of hypnotherapy among PWH, with positive lead to regulating bleeding, minimizing discomfort and alleviating stress27,28,29. Various other investigations, describing images and relaxation strategies similar to hypnotherapy, have additionally attained decreases in arthritic discomfort for PWH undergoing intervention38,39. Remarkably, the last reports of research studies evaluating the efficacy of hypnosis in the haemophilia area date from the very early 90's. To our expertise, no more current research was performed on this topic, hence the relevance of additional exploring this issue.
